Can someone please help?
I have this in my .emacs:
(add-to-list 'auto-mode-alist '("\\.ph$" . php-html-helper-mode))
The problem is that my auto-load-alist looks like this:
(("\\.php$" . php-html-helper-mode)
("\\.ht,$" . html-helper-mode)
("\\.muse\\'" . muse-mode-choose-mode)
("\\.wy$" . wisent-grammar-mode)
("\\.by$" . bovine-grammar-mode)
("Project\\.ede" . emacs-lisp-mode)
("\\.\\(xml\\|xsl\\|rng\\|xhtml\\)\\'" . nxml-mode)
("\\.u?deb$" . deb-view-mode)
("sources.list$" . apt-sources-mode)
("\\.php$" . c-mode)
("\\.php3\\'" . php-mode)
("\\.php[34]?\\'\\|\\.phtml\\." . php-mode)
("\\.php$" . php-html-helper-mode)
("\\.asp$" . html-helper-mode)
("\\.jsp$" . jsp-html-helper-mode)
*snip*
I guess this is debian autoloads setting this up for me, but how to I
specify php files to open in php-html-helper mode, as they are currently
opening in c-mode.
